Authenticated code execution via unchecked s_aid copy
Published Jan 11, 2023 · Updated Apr 8, 2025
Stack-based buffer overflow in the Insteon Hub 1012 PubNub handler allows remote authenticated users to execute arbitrary code. The cmd s_event_alarm handler passes the attacker-controlled s_aid string to strcpy, which writes beyond a 32-byte stack buffer without checking its length. Access to the PubNub service and an authenticated HTTP request are required; successful exploitation overwrites arbitrary data and can execute code on the hub.
